The Indian Medical Council (Amendment) Bill, 2018, which seeks constitution of a Board of Governors that will exercise the powers of the Medical Council of India (MCI) was passed in the Lok Sabha on Monday. The Bill was introduced on December 14 in the Lok Sabha by Union Health and Family Welfare Minister, which was earlier brought in as an ordinance on September 26 this year when the Parliament was not in session. Under the new amendment, the Bill provides for the supersession of the MCI for a period of one year. Running the government has now become a new way of ‘ ruling the country via ordinance”.
